Mentmore Golf Club features parkland layouts set within the rolling Buckinghamshire countryside, characterized by mature trees and strategic water hazards. The course design emphasizes precision over power, rewarding players who can shape shots to suit the natural undulations. Its elevated position offers significant wind exposure, making club selection a primary variable.

Prioritise position off the tee to ensure clear angles into the medium-sized greens, many of which are protected by bunkers or water. Managing the changes in elevation is vital for distance control on approach shots. When the wind picks up, playing to the fat part of the green is often more effective than hunting pins.

The key to a low score lies in navigating the par fives effectively while maintaining discipline on the more exposed par threes. Scoring opportunities are frequent on the shorter par fours if the tee shot finds the fairway, allowing for aggressive wedge play. Consistent putting on the undulating surfaces is required to convert birdie chances.

Over-attacking the pins located near water hazards often results in avoidable penalty strokes. Golfers frequently underestimate the impact of elevation changes on club selection, leading to shots falling short or flying long. Ignoring the prevailing wind on exposed sections of the course can quickly derail a stable round.

Mentmore Golf Club rewards discipline and clear decision-making. Check the wind direction at the clubhouse before starting, as it dictates play on several exposed holes. Always take an extra club for uphill approaches to ensure you clear front-side bunkering. Practise short-game recovery shots from various lies, as missing the green on the high side leaves a challenging downhill chip.
